How they compare

Belgium currently reports 387,473 t against 330,549 t in China, a difference of 56,924 t.

That makes Belgium's figure about 1.2 times China's.

The two have swapped places 8 times across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Belgium ahead.

Belgium ranks 11th and China ranks 13th of 213 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Belgium averaged higher in 2 and China in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Belgium China Difference Ahead
2000s 466,675 t 265,390 t 201,285 t Belgium
2010s 340,546 t 291,785 t 48,761 t Belgium
2020s 368,332 t 455,119 t 86,787 t China

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The Fertilizers by Nutrient dataset contains information on the totals in nutrients for Production, Trade and Agriculture Use of inorganic (chemical or mineral) fertilizers. The data are provided for the three primary plant nutrients: nitrogen (N), phosphorus (expressed as P2O5) and potassium (expressed as K2O). Both straight and compound fertilizers are included.
